About the role

As we continue to grow and scale we are looking to add this pivotal new role of Transactional Finance Manager to the finance department. This role will manage the global AP/AR, billing, banking and treasury functions of the finance department across our four entities; UK, Spain, Germany and Portugal. The role is based in the head office in London and will report directly to the financial controller and will be hybrid working, but would consider fully remote working.

Responsibilities

  • Full management of the Accounts Payable and Accounts Receivable functions
  • All banking and expense transactions
  • Responsible for working capital management including payment runs
  • Processing and management of PO system and liaising with stakeholders across the business
  • Responsible for handling queries both external and internally
  • Reviewing AR ledgers and escalating any aged debt
  • Drive improvements of transactional and billing processes through automation
  • Management of 1 direct report (in Portugal) but day to day supervision of all AP/AR related work across the business (UK, Portugal, Germany and Spain)

The FlexScore® is the result of a rigorous 2-step verification of a company’s flexibility

First we assess the flexibility options carwow provides and then we anonymously survey a statistically significant proportion of their employees to make sure carwow is as flexible as they say they are. Our assessment is based on the six key elements of flexibility: location, hours, autonomy, benefits, role modelling and work-life balance.
